Development And Improvement Research Of Thermochromic Window Screen

The development of thermochromic materials has a history of more than one hundred years,the emergence of microcapsules has greatly promoted the development of thermochromic discoloration.With resin will color material coated in its interior,made in diameter of dozens of microns to hundreds of microcapsules,isolation the internal discoloration material from the complex environment,make its use in the field of textile.It also makes it possible to apply thermochromic materials in medical and health care,military clothing and daily necessities.Thermochromic window screen is printed by screen printing method,giving the monotonous color screen window with bright and colorful pattern,the print pattern can change color,fade or achromatism with the change of temperature.The effects of the amount of adhesive,thickener,drying time and drying temperature on the color depth,dry rubbing color fastness,wet rubbing color fastness,washing resistance and resistance to brush and wash color fastness of printing patterns were investigated by orthogonal test.The printing quality and discoloration performance of the pattern prepared by improving the formula are good.To evaluate the performance of printed color paste prepared by 24? blue,green and red thermochromic microcapsules and 32? blue,green,orange and red thermochromic microcapsules,It is found that the color saturation S value of the thermochromic color-changing window screen prepared by these thermochromic microcapsules will decrease sharply with the increase of temperature within a certain temperature range,and the color discoloration temperature of several thermochromic color-changing microcapsules of 24?is between 22 and26?.Several 32? thermochromic microcapsules are colorization temperature between 31-35?.Selection of these a few thermochromic microcapsules in 50 times after heating and cooling cycle still has a better color performance,thus discoloration microcapsule made of printing design has good color restorative and durability,after repeated use still maintain its good color performance,Meet the needs of actual use.Of 32?,green,yellow and red yellow 32? thermochromic microcapsule preparation of printing paste,after 50 times heating and cooling test still has a better color performance,low temperature when the color hue H value had no obvious change after 50 times of trial and error,high temperature when the color hue H value had no obvious change after50 times of trial and error,It indicates that the two thermochromic microcapsules selected have good color recovery,so the printing pattern made by thermochromic microcapsules has good color recovery and durability,and still keeps its good color-changing performance after repeated use,which meets the needs of actual use.Several thermochromic window screen with better temperature response behavior are designed.The experiment explored the influence of sun fastness promoter and uv absorber on the sun resistance and printing quality of thermochromic window screen when acting alone.The effects of light stabilizer Tinuvin770 on sun resistance and printing quality were investigated.With the increase of Tinuvin770 addition amount,the color difference between Tinuvin770 and non-Tinuvin770 thermochromic window screen will also increase,but the effect is not significant,Tinuvin770 addition will not change the printing quality of thermochromic window screen,dry,wet and water fastness grades remain unchanged.The effects of three kinds of UV absorbent and Tinuvin770 synergistic action on the sun-resistant performance and printing quality of the thermochromic window screen were investigated.Through the experiment,it was found that 2% of the light stabilizer Tinuvin770 could coordinate with 6% of the UV absorber UV-329 to better improve the sun-resistant performance of thethermochromic window screen.Moreover,the synergistic effect of the UV absorber UV-329 and the photostabilizer Tinuvin770 is better than that of the UV absorber UV-327 and UV-531 with the photostabilizer Tinuvin770.
